Dog sunglasses are a good choice for almost any dog in certain situations But some breeds have particularly

vulnerable eyes

. Brachycephalic (short-nosed) breeds and mixes are more susceptible to an eye injury. These include pugs, French bulldogs, Shih Tzus, and Boston terriers.

Eyewear should be comfortable and fit properly, Stine says. “All sunglasses for dogs are going to be

goggle-style glasses

with straps. No dog is going to keep human-style sunglasses on for long” The dog goggles or visor shouldn’t impede your dog’s lifestyle.

Sunlight Bad: Is sunlight bad for dogs eyes

Like humans, we need to consider eye protection for dogs because harmful UV rays from the sun can cause eye conditions likepannus, sunburn around the eyes, and cataracts.

Dogs Eyes: How can I protect my dogs eyes

GOGGLES, VISORS AND MASKS They effectively shield eyes from grasses, brush and projectile debris. Tinting is available in most devices to provide UV light protection, especially beneficial to dogs with chronic superficial keratitis (“pannus”), a condition exacerbated by UV sun exposure.

How cold is too cold for a Chihuahua?


Chihuahua:

The temperature that is too cold for Chihuahuas is around 4 degrees Celsius (40 degrees Fahrenheit) This can be too cold, and if combined with wet weather, or with older dogs or puppies, the danger is increased. If your Chihuahua is lifting their paws off the ground, then it’s obviously way too cold for them.

Snow Blindness: Can dogs get snow blindness

Can dogs get snow blindness? Dogs do get snow blindness (also known as photokeratitis), but it is very rare due to them having more pigment in their irises than humans However, there have been documented cases where dogs have suffered with the UV glare from the sun and snow, leading to eye problems.

Dog Glasses: What do dog glasses look like

Doggles look similar to a pair of underwater goggles that a human would wear They have a foam padding that sits between the Doggles frame and the dog’s face. Doggles are flexible and can fit any face shape.
